Intern on an Organic Farm in Costa Rica and receive personal development opportunities

This internship immerses you in the practices of bio-dynamic farming. You will work alongside a dedicated staff supervisor to ensure you maximise your placement, cultural and learning activities, as you help harvest the organic herbs and produce, take care of the animals and be immersed in the practices of bio-dynamic farming. Finca Luna Nueva is a working organic and bio-dynamic farm which is establishing itself as a leading resource centre for Central America. The overall aim of the program is to impact sustainable practices throughout Central America. This internship will allow you to make a real difference to the resource centre whilst also gaining invaluable hands on practical experience in a variety of fields including project management and team leadership.

At Luna, there is a wonderful resource to educate people. It offers so much knowledge about organics, the rainforest, our natural resources and how our decisions affect our world. By combining organics education with volunteering, we are offering people the opportunity to make a real difference, both during their stay and when they arrive back home

What Difference Does This Internship Make?

Volunteers will be working alongside project staff, sustainability specialists, and farm workers to develop and maintain sustainable farming initiatives. As Luna Nueva continues to grow both in area and as a regional resource centre, it will benefit the area tremendously. The farm will be able to supply more jobs and financial stability to the local community directly as well as indirectly through the increased tourism. Additionally, their work on rainforest preservation will bring invaluable environmental benefits to the region and the planet.

Location

Volunteers’ accommodation is on a private rainforest reserve is located adjacent to the 54,000 acre Children’s Eternal Rainforest (‘CERF’) conservation area. The views and wildlife are spectacular, with Arenal Volcano (Costa Rica’s most active volcano) a majestic site to behold on the horizon. Finca Luna Nueva is near the town of La Fortuna, about a 3 to 4 hour journey by minibus from the capital city of San Jose.

Field Conditions

Volunteers will be based at Finca Luna Nueva, housing will be basic, yet comfortable, dorm style in a house located near the lodge’s office, or in nearby homestays. The food is very typical of the area, and is varied, including meats a couple of times a week, vegetables and fruits, some of which are produced right from the farm. Vegetarians and vegans are also well catered for. The accommodation includes three meals a day, a packed lunch is provided when working. With the close proximity to the lodge and nearby town La Fortuna, optional additional excursions and spa services may be available at an additional cost.
